They are discovered by the gigantic, ugly, and miserable Bergens, who believe they can only feel happy by consuming a Troll. The Bergens imprison the Trolls in a caged tree and eat them every year on a special occasion called Trollstice.

Bergens were the Troll’s only predator. Trolls reproduced and Bergens ate them. Over ages, the Trolls reproduction rate and Bergens appetites evolved to keep both species in balance.

The Bergens are a species of creatures seen in Trolls, Trolls Holiday, Trolls: The Beat Goes On!, Trolls Band Together and various related media. They used to be type of monsters that ate Trolls. They’re currently led by King Gristle Jr.

The Bergens caged the Troll Tree for Trollstice. After discovering the Trolls and feeling happy after eating them, the Bergens caged the Troll Tree and created a tradition where once a year, they would gather around the Troll tree and each would get a feeling of happiness by eating a Troll.

What do trolls eat and drink?

The known diet traits among the Trolls include:

  • The Pop Trolls eat critters and sweets such as cakes and ice cream.
  • The Rock Trolls consume packaged food and drinks.
  • The Country Trolls drink milk and eat meat from Buffalo-like creatures.
  • The Classical Trolls tend to eat Eighth Goats.

Why do trolls hate bells?

The Norse folkloric belief in trolls is clearly a holdover from the pre-Christian era and in legend the trolls do not like Christianity one bit. The sound of church bells is said to drive them away.

Who created trolls?

Troll dolls were created in 1959 by Danish fisherman and woodcutter Thomas Dam. Dam could not afford a Christmas gift for his young daughter Lila and carved the doll from his imagination.
